Exhaust Question
Has any one on here done any looking into replacing their muffler on either an AC 400 or AC 500 with one used on a small lawn tractor?
I am needing to replace my exhaust AGAIN! and I found a muffler the exact same size off a Sears lawn tractor. I happened to be inthe store and looked at the muffler and thought...hey that might work? I can get one for $85 new while the AC or other aftermarket mufflers are like $150 and up.
I was thinking of buying one and cutting the end off it to see what kind of baffles it has in it to make sure it has the same of similar flow as the stock muffler.
If any one has some info on this I would appreciate it. I am just getting tired of paying $200 for a muffler every 3 years.

I ride on a salt water beach and no mater how much you wash or what spray you use the muffler rusts up fast. I have not used an aftermarket muffer as they again are like $200 the stock AC mufflers are not cheap either! All it takes after a little rust is to back into a stick in the brush and it punches a hole in the muffler. After a few holes muffler tape just won't seal it anymore and the packing blows out and it gets VERY loud and annoying.
T-cat, do you know of a way to calculate the flow of a muffler? I figured I wold need to change my jetting a little but I figured if it off too much then fuel ecomony would suffer OR I would have no power as flow is being restricted.

Normally you would check your plugs after a short WOT run,now i'm not sure if the same procedure will work for a 4 stroke,the other method is for a 2 stroke. The plug will still give you a fairly accurate reading. You will be looking for a nice brown colour. It will also depend on how much difference in size inside, not outside the muffler, hope this helps.

Well I went ahead and bought one and I am going to cut it open on the end the exhaust comes out and have a look at how many baffles there are and how large the air passages through the baffles are. I am also going to do the same to my rusted stock muffler and I am hoping I can make a comparison on area of opennings for air flow and such. The O.D. dimensions are 1/4 inch shorter and 1/8 inch in diameter difference than stock AC muffler. Inlet and outlet ports are smae size. Plus I got this thing for $42!
If all looks good I will install it and give it a WOT test and check my plug color. I wilal let you know what I find.
